Why is it important to have an updated client record system?

  1. To remind clients of their last visit

  2. To track services and allergies for returning clients

  3. To promote new services to clients

  4. To manage inventory effectively

The correct answer is: To track services and allergies for returning clients

Having an updated client record system is crucial primarily because it allows barbers and cosmetologists to track services rendered and allergies for returning clients. By maintaining detailed and accurate records, professionals can provide personalized service that takes into consideration individual preferences, past treatments, and any reactions to products or procedures. Understanding a client's history greatly enhances the ability to deliver safe and effective services. For example, if a client has a known allergy to a specific ingredient or product, the barber can avoid using it, thereby preventing potential reactions. Moreover, tracking previous services helps in tailoring future treatments to better meet the client's needs, ensuring satisfaction and fostering a strong client relationship. While reminding clients of their last visit, promoting new services, and managing inventory are all valuable aspects of salon management, they do not directly impact client safety and personalized care to the same extent as tracking services and allergies. Therefore, the emphasis on maintaining up-to-date records serves a foundational role in delivering quality care and building trust with clients.
